Career
Frederico Crissiúma de Figueiredo is a distinguished criminal lawyer in Brazil, and has been sought after for complex white-collar and litigation cases for over 25 years. His extensive experience encompasses white-collar crimes, money laundering, corruption allegations, cross-border investigations, and various other aspects of the criminal spectrum. Among his clients are prominent national and international companies from sectors such as construction, pharmaceuticals, banking, food and beverages, and others.
He graduated from the Pontifical Catholic University of São Paulo (PUC-SP) and is a member of the Criminal Committee of the Center for the Study of Law Firms (CESA).
Frederico has served two terms as State Counselor of the São Paulo Bar Association (OAB-SP) and was vice-president of the Selection and Registration Committee, as well as a member of the 4th Appeals Chamber and the Prerogatives Council. He also taught for several years in the postgraduate program in Economic Criminal Law at the Public Law Institute of São Paulo (IDP-SP). Furthermore, he has authored numerous legal articles published in journals. In addition to his professional practice, Frederico is highly regarded for his pro bono activities.
